Looks like those grand plans of turning the old Tasca space into a private dining room for Sheridan Square have fallen through. The owners realized that a tapas/wine bar will have a better chance of raking in some profits: "Per KBHall, the space is now scheduled to reopen in September as a wine-and-tapas bar called Tierra. Franklin Becker will be providing the Mediterranean fare while still cooking next door and Sterling Roig will be running the wine elements in this West Village 40-seater." [Zagat]
